  • Gangtok : Gangtok is the capital of the mountainous northern Indian state of Sikkim. Established as Buddhist pilgrimage site in the 1840s, the city became capital of an independent monarchy after British rule ended, but joined India in 1975. Today, it remains a Tibetan Buddhist center and a base for hikers organizing permits and transport for treks through Sikkim’s Himalayan Mountain Ranges.
  • Darjeeling: Darjeeling is a town in India's West Bengal state, in the Himalayan foothills. Once a summer resort for the British Raj elite, it remains the terminus of the narrow-gauge Darjeeling Himalayan Railway, or “Toy Train,” completed in 1881. It's famed for the distinctive black tea grown on plantations that dot its surrounding slopes. Its backdrop is Mt. Kanchenjunga, among the world’s highest peaks.

In the morning after breakfast, proceeds for Visit to Changu (Tsomgo) Lake and New Baba Mandir, its takes nearly 48 kms & nearly 2 hours drive through cool, serene water and the picturesque beauty. Tsomgo Lake is one of the holy lakes of the region - A temple of Lord Shiva is built on the lakeside. Primula flowers and other alpine plantation provide an immaculate beauty to this place. Till April it is full of snow and lay frozen. After Excursion, back to hotel for lunch or lunch on the way. The rest of the day is free to stroll around MG Marg or Local Market. During this journey, you will stop at Namchi where you will be going for sightseeing of Chardham (Siddhe Shwar Dham), Temi Tea Garden, Samdruptse ( Ravangla ) Hill & Ngadak Monastery. At the Siddhe Shwar Dham, you can see a replica of all the 12 Jyotirlingas and four Dhams and 108 feet high statue of Lord Shiva.
